Key Differences
In short — Lenovo Legion Pro 5 outperforms the cheaper Acer Nitro V on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Acer Nitro V is a better bang for your buck.
Advantages of Lenovo Legion Pro 5 Gaming Laptop
- Performs up to 9% better in Elden Ring than Acer Nitro V - 88 vs 81 FPS
Advantages of Acer Nitro V Gaming Laptop
- Up to 54% cheaper than Lenovo Legion Pro 5 - $927.92 vs $1999.10
- Up to 50% better value when playing Elden Ring than Lenovo Legion Pro 5 - $11.46 vs $22.72 per FPS
